โฮมเพจ » ทำอย่างไร » เรียนรู้ที่ Windows 8 เก็บข้อมูลตัวกรอง SmartScreen สำหรับไฟล์ที่ดาวน์โหลด

    เรียนรู้ที่ Windows 8 เก็บข้อมูลตัวกรอง SmartScreen สำหรับไฟล์ที่ดาวน์โหลด

    ใน Windows รุ่นก่อนหน้าตัวกรอง SmartScreen เป็นคุณสมบัติของ Internet Explorer โดย Windows 8 จะกลายเป็นส่วนหนึ่งของระบบไฟล์ Windows แต่จะทราบได้อย่างไรว่าไฟล์ใดบ้างที่ถูกดาวน์โหลดและไฟล์ใดที่มาจากพีซีของคุณ อ่านต่อไปเพื่อดูว่า How-To Geek ทำการสำรวจในระบบไฟล์อย่างไร.

    หมายเหตุ: ข้อมูลที่ให้ไว้ในบทความนี้มีวัตถุประสงค์เพื่อการศึกษาเท่านั้น.

    ดังนั้นอะไรคือเวทมนตร์?

    ความมหัศจรรย์ที่ใช้ที่นี่จริง ๆ แล้วประกอบด้วยเทคโนโลยีที่ค่อนข้างง่าย.

    แม้ว่าคุณจะสามารถเข้าถึงการตั้งค่าสำหรับโซนอินเทอร์เน็ตเหล่านี้ผ่าน Internet Explorer เท่านั้น แต่จะถูกใช้ในสถานที่ต่าง ๆ ทั่วทั้ง Windows เมื่อใดก็ตามที่คุณดาวน์โหลดไฟล์ที่มาจากโซนอินเทอร์เน็ตไฟล์นั้นจะถูกติดแท็กด้วยตัวระบุโซนพิเศษและตัวระบุนี้จะถูกเก็บไว้ในสตรีมข้อมูลสำรอง เมื่อต้องการดูสิ่งนี้ฉันตัดสินใจที่จะเปิดภาษาสคริปต์ที่ชื่นชอบ PowerShell ฉันเขียนสคริปต์ต่อไปนี้เพื่อดูสตรีมข้อมูลสำรองของแต่ละไฟล์ในโฟลเดอร์ดาวน์โหลดของฉัน.

    $ Files = Get-ChildItem -Path C: \ Users \ Taylor \ Downloads
    foreach ($ File ใน $ Files)

    รับรายการ $ File ชื่อเต็ม - สตรีม *

    คุณเห็นว่าไฟล์สุดท้ายในรายการมันมีสตรีมข้อมูลเพิ่มเติมที่เรียกว่า Zone.Identifier นั่นคือสิ่งที่เรากำลังพูดถึง เมื่อคุณเปิดไฟล์ใน Windows ระบบจะตรวจสอบสตรีมข้อมูลพิเศษนี้และเรียกใช้ SmartScreen หากมีอยู่ ในแบบที่เกินจริงเราตัดสินใจที่จะแอบเข้าไปในกระแสข้อมูลเพื่อดูว่ามีข้อมูลอะไรเก็บอยู่.

    รับรายการ -Path C: \ Users \ Taylor \ Downloads \ socketsniff.zip - โซนสตรีม * | ได้รับการบริการเนื้อหา

    แม้ว่านั่นอาจไม่ได้มีความหมายอะไรสำหรับเรา แต่ก็ทำให้เราคิดอย่างแน่นอนว่าเราจะใช้ SmartScreen ได้อย่างไร.

    วิธีการหลีกเลี่ยง SmartScreen ใน Windows 8

    วิธีแรกในการหลีกเลี่ยงคือการใช้ GUI หากคุณมีไฟล์ที่มีสตรีมข้อมูล Zone.Identifier คุณสามารถปลดบล็อกได้อย่างง่ายดายจากคุณสมบัติของไฟล์ เพียงคลิกขวาที่ไฟล์และเปิดคุณสมบัติของมันจากเมนูบริบทแล้วคลิกปุ่มปลดล็อคดังนั้นตอนนี้เมื่อคุณเปิดไฟล์ SmartScreen จะไม่ถูกเรียก.

    คุณสามารถใช้ไฟล์ปลดบล็อกใหม่ cmdlet ใน PowerShell 3 ซึ่งเทียบเท่ากับสคริปต์ของการคลิกปุ่มปลดบล็อก.

    $ Files = Get-ChildItem -Path C: \ Users \ Taylor \ Downloads
    foreach ($ File ใน $ Files)

    เลิกบล็อกไฟล์ -Path $ File.Fullname

    วิธีสุดท้ายในการหลีกเลี่ยง SmartScreen คือเพียงเพิ่มเว็บไซต์ที่คุณกำลังดาวน์โหลดจากลงในอินทราเน็ตโซนใน Internet Explorer.

    แน่นอนว่าเราไม่แนะนำให้คุณทำเช่นนั้นเนื่องจากโซนนั้นสงวนไว้สำหรับไซต์อินทราเน็ตและจะทำให้คุณเสี่ยงต่อมัลแวร์ที่มาจากไซต์เหล่านั้นในรายการและในบันทึกนั้นฉันปล่อยให้คุณใช้สคริปต์นี้เพื่อค้นหาไฟล์บนพีซีของคุณ มีต้นกำเนิดมาจากโซนอินเทอร์เน็ต.

    $ Files = Get-ChildItem -Path C: \ Users \ Taylor \ Downloads
    foreach ($ File ใน $ Files)

    รับรายการ $ File.FullName -Stream * | % if ($ _. Stream-like“ Zone *”) $ File.Name

    นั่นคือทั้งหมดที่มีให้มัน.